What is your typical process for working with clients?
My approach begins with a comprehensive psychiatric evaluation where we discuss your current concerns, symptoms, medical and mental health history, lifestyle factors, stressors, and treatment goals. I take time to understand the full picture so that we can develop an individualized treatment plan tailored to your specific needs.
During follow-up visits, we review your progress, discuss any changes in symptoms, evaluate how medications are working if prescribed, and address any concerns or side effects. I believe treatment works best when patients feel actively involved in the process, so sessions are collaborative, supportive, and focused on helping you achieve meaningful improvement in your overall well-being.
In addition to medication management, I incorporate supportive therapeutic techniques, psychoeducation, coping strategies, and lifestyle-focused recommendations when appropriate. I also encourage coordination with therapists, primary care providers, and other members of your healthcare team to support comprehensive care. My goal is to provide a safe, respectful, and nonjudgmental space where patients feel heard, supported, and empowered throughout their mental health journey.
